How to root a tulip tree
WebTo grow from seed, plant the seeds immediately in fall, or cold moist stratify them for 90 days in the refrigerator in a moist growing medium. Planting depth should be fairly shallow, approximately 1/8″ deep (3 mm). Webtulip tree, (Liriodendron tulipifera), also called yellow poplar or whitewood, North American ornamental and timber tree of the magnolia family (Magnoliaceae), order Magnoliales, not related to the true poplars. The tulip tree occurs in mixed-hardwood stands in eastern North America. It is taller than all other eastern broad-leaved trees, and its trunk often has a …
